    Karen - in order to make sure that you get all your entitlements and to do everything by the book you must get your MATB1 to your employer by the end of your 25th week of pregnancy. You can have it from 20 weeks.
    I am doign everything by the book so that my work don't turn around and try and say 'oh but you didn't get your letter to us on time!'
